Commerce and Insurance finalizes electrical-rule updates, formalizes third-party plan-review option

Summary

The Department of Commerce and Insurance updated electrical installation rules to reflect a 45-day limit for temporary service releases, restructured recreational-vehicle inspection fees, and finalized permanent rules for third-party plans review and inspections allowed by 2024 statute; the committee advanced the package.

The Department of Commerce and Insurance presented a set of permanent rule updates for electrical installations and for third-party plans review and inspection that reflect statutory changes adopted in Public Chapter 771 (2024).
